Amherst College Second Cook in Amherst, Massachusetts

AMHERST SEE WEBSITE FOR FULL JOB DESCRIPTION Second Cook Job Description: Amherst College invites applications for the Second Cook. The Second Cook is a full-time, year-round position, starting at \$21.35 per hour. The Second Cook supports the efforts of Amherst College Dining Services in providing the diverse campus community with excellent service and production of our menus. This position assists the culinary team with the production and implementation of menu items. This position ensures that the quantity and quality of our production are consistent with our standards and works with all members of the team to meet and exceed the expectations of our customers. This individual produces menu components from fresh and exceptional ingredients and is proficient in the technical skill and knowledge required to achieve this, being well versed in food, its history, and trends. The work schedule corresponds to the College\'s operational needs. This position may assist with morning coverage in student dining or assist with catering and campus-wide events. As our work is central to student life, their needs occur at a variety of times throughout the day, week, and year and in such, a flexible schedule with extended shift times is required. In addition, the position is designated as providing essential services and should report to work, or remain on duty even though the College is closed. Qualifications: Required High School Diploma or equivalent Current ServSafe Manager Certification or be able to achieve within (6) months of employment Allergen Awareness as required by the Commonwealth of Massachusetts Five years of food preparation experience including hot and cold food production, high volume production, buffet presentation, a la carte cooking, baking, and pastry Strong verbal and written communication, customer service, organizational, and time management skills Ability to taste and work with any and all ingredients used Ability to mathematically reduce and expand measurements required by the recipe Attention to detail Ability to work flexible hours based upon departmental needs including extended shifts Preferred Associate\'s degree or equivalent in Culinary Arts Supervisory experience Amherst College offers many opportunities for professional growth and development, continued learning, and career advancement. Summary of Responsibilities: Production Support the operational standards and Health Department regulations Ensure all areas are maintained in an orderly, clean, and sanitary manner, as well as oversee the complete breakdown and cleaning of all equipment Ensure production of menu items are to standard Ensure recipes are followed, uniform production standards are met, and all items are of the highest possible quality Supervision Provide operational supervision, both directly and in conjunction with the First Cook, over the daily culinary operations while supporting the culinary team with the planning, production and implementation of menus and systems Participate in employee training and development and the assessment of team member performance Provide and maintain the tools, information, resources, and support necessary to enable individual and the team\'s success Coach and Supervise service staff on storage, portioning, and handling of menu items Perform regular inspections of Stations and Service areas in support of established standards Maintain the accuracy of production schedules, usage reports, and communicate deficiencies
